This case is taken from pgs. 16-17 of Writing Arguments.

The homeless stood up for themselves by sitting down in a peaceful but vocal protest yesterday in [name of city-Chesapeake, perhaps].

About 50 people met at noon to criticize a proposed set of city ordinances that would ban panhandlers from sitting on sidewalks, put them in jail for repeatedly urinating in public, and crack down on "intimidating" street behavior.

"Sitting is not a crime," read poster boards that feature mug shots of [the city attorney] who is pushing for the new laws.  "This is city property; the police want to tell us we can't sit here," yelled one man named R.C. as he sat cross-legged outside a pizza establishment.
